DESCRIPTION:

PD9 is a pared down version of the traditional big bands of the 1930s, and they frequently feature guest vocalists, adding to the versatility of the band's show. The number of musicians in the lineup is reminiscent of the earliest big bands, when swing was still evolving into the sound that defined jazz music's most popular era.

If you have not yet experienced Planet D Nonet, your groove tank is missing out on some serious fuel.  

They're Detroit's own down and dirty little big band, known nationally for curating some of the best in early jazz traditions and Black-American musical influences from the 20s, 30s and 40s. More "hot" than "sweet," according to PD9 cofounder and bandleader RJ Spangler, who started the nine piece ensemble with longtime musical partner James O'Donnell in 2007.
